Who is Sarah Chapman? The Network's Story
When we talk about "Sarah Chapman" in this context, we're really referring to a wonderful network of hospitals that specializes in helping people get back on their feet. This institution, which is quite independent, was formally established under Brazilian federal law #8.246/91 on October 22. It’s run by a group called the Associação das Pioneiras Sociais (APS), a body that oversees its operations and makes sure everything runs smoothly. A Glimpse into Sarah Chapman Locations
The "Sarah Chapman" network has some really interesting and thoughtfully placed facilities. Take the Sarah Belém pediatric rehabilitation center, for instance. It's located quite close to the Guajará Bay and first opened its doors in December 2007. This particular center specializes in the neurorehabilitation of children, which is a very specific and important area of care. It’s pretty amazing to think about the specialized help they offer to young people in that region.
Then there's the Sarah International Center for Neurorehabilitation and Neurosciences, which was inaugurated in May 2009. You can find this center in Rio’s Barra da Tijuca, and it welcomes both adults and children who are dealing with acquired conditions or injuries. This means it helps a wide range of individuals facing different challenges, providing advanced care in a significant urban area.
